Biotin-HPDP, also known as N-[6-(Biotinamido)hexyl]-3’-(2’-pyridyldithio)-propionamide, is a sulfhydryl reactive biotinylation reagent with a long chain, cleavable spacer arm.

More Info
Biotin-HPDP biotinylation occurs between pH 6-9 through its pyridyldithiol group reacting with sulfhydryls to form a stable disulfide bond. The 29.2 angstrom spacer arm prevents steric hindrance and may also be cleaved at the disulfide bond using TCEP-HCl, DTT or ß-Mercaptoethanol. Biotin-HPDP must be dissolved in an organic solvent, such as DMSO or DMF, then added to an aqueous biotinylation reaction. The resulting biotinylated protein can then be detected when used in conjunction with streptavidin or Immobilized Streptavidin.
